The average time spent (compiled using publicly available data from comScore and Alexa) on the web declined 2.4%, from 72 minutes to 70 minutes year-over-year. Social networking accounts for 26% of consumers’ time on mobile apps, followed by entertainment and utility, each at 10%.

The overall social networking population across mobile devices increased by 37% to 72 million people – about 31% of all U.S. mobile users (aged 13 and over).
